What is the difference between Internship Microchip Design Engineer vs Microchip Design Engineer?

AspectInternship Microchip Design EngineerMicrochip Design Engineer
QualificationsEnrolled in or recent graduate of relevant engineering programBachelor's or Master's in Electrical/Electronic Engineering
Work EnvironmentInternship, supervised, learning-focusedFull-time professional role, project-driven
ResponsibilitiesAssist in design, testing, and documentationDesign, develop, and validate microchip circuits independently
Industry UsageEntry-level, internship programs in semiconductor companiesFull-time positions in similar companies

In summary, an Internship Microchip Design Engineer is a temporary, learning-focused role for students or recent graduates, whereas a Microchip Design Engineer is a full-time professional responsible for designing and developing microchips independently. The internship provides hands-on experience, while the full-time role involves more responsibility and expertise.

JOB SUMMARY
We are seeking a skilled Mechanical Engineer to join our team developing automated mobile heavy equipment that removes humans from dull, dirty, and dangerous jobs. In this role, you will design, draft and support innovative systems that advance safety and efficiency in demanding industrial environments.
Key Responsibilities
  • Create and manage CAD models and drawings, including importing, simplifying, and documenting designs.
  • Develop CAD models of existing hardware to support integration and improvement.
  • Collaborate with product owners to define requirements and ensure designs meet performance, safety, and usability goals.
  • On shape Modeling: Organize 3D sheet metal parts and complex, multi-part assemblies using on-shape.
  • Drawings & GD&T: Create detailed 2D fabrication drawings (PDF) including proper GD&T (ASME Y14.5), annotations, welding symbols, and bend information.
  • Sheet Metal Optimization: Design sheet metal parts, create flat patterns for fabrication.
  • Assemblies & BOMs: Manage large assembly files, including hardware, sub-assemblies, and generate accurate Bills of Materials (BOMs) including electrical drawing revisions and buyout part information.
  • Documentation Control: Maintain, update, and revise drawings and assemblies based on engineering change requests. (ECRs)
  • Attention to Detail: This person will be able to catch mistakes while reviewing drawings, assemblies and ask questions related to each BOM that will enhance the product and correct any issues before drawings and BOMs are finalized.
  • Provide technical input to support the creation of assembly documentation, operator manuals, and maintenance guides.

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or related field (Master's a plus).
  • 1 to 4 years of experience working in Robotics/Automotive or similar domain.
  • Good experience in mechanical design, automation, robotics, or related areas (internships count).
  • Proficiency in CAD software (On-shape - preferred, SolidWorks, Creo, or similar) for modeling and drawing creation.
  • Basic understanding of mechanical systems, materials, and manufacturing methods.
  • Good understanding of GD&T and Welding process.
  • Hands-on experience with prototyping, testing, or hardware builds preferred.
  • Basic understanding of pneumatic and hydraulic systems
  • Strong communication skills and ability to work effectively in cross-functional teams.
  • Demonstrated interest in automation, robotics, or safety-critical systems is a plus.
